 The Shiprepair Yard "TEREM" PLC - Varna branch (ex."Flotski Arsenal"), the pioneer in shiprepair industry in Bulgaria, with pleasure welcome you to our website.Our Shiprepair Yard was founded in 1897. The long history of our company, extensive experience of our skilled and efficient staff, well equipped workshops, docks and other facilities enable us to offer complex ship repair of high quality and short time at attractive prices.

 “Viktor Lenac” Shipyard is today one of the major ship repair / conversion / offshore shipyards in the Mediterranean. Founded in 1896, the yard is located 3 km south of the port of Rijeka in Croatia.

 The shipyard deals with ship repair activities for river ships.In September 1991 the former Shipbuilding and Shiprepairing Yard "Ivan Dimitrov" was registered as Rousse Shipyard Ltd. In April 1999 Rousse Shipyard was privatized by Rousse Shipyard Beteiligungsgesellschaft mbH - Germany.

 The shipyard has more than 50-years experience. Started as a small repair shop in 1948, it grew up into a modern shipbuilding and repair yard. From the very beginning it built up a good reputation and now enjoys popularity, based on established traditions in shipbuilding, good production quality and competitive prices. At that time the yard could build small vessels only. Since 1970 the yard move from the its area at port of Bourgas to its nowadays territory where can be built vessels up to 25000 dwt.

 The Shipyard, founded in 1911, is located in the Port of Naples.It is 6 km far from Naples International Airport and in connection with road track to speedway. The Shipyard covers an area of 160.000 mq including workshops, service buildings, drydocks and repair quay.

 MEGATECHNICA LTD has been operating in the Repair Zone of Piraeus since 1992. The background of the company founders is traced back in 1961 and their credentials is their participation in big construction,repair and conversion works, either as businessmen or as key emloyees in other companies. It was not later than two years after the company formation, in 1994, MEGATECHNICA has decided to invest in the purchase of its own Slipway, in Perama, which was soon refurbished and outfitted with new buildings and equipment. Today, it has the capacity to serve ships of length up to 95m long and up to 1,500 tons, on four positions, and provide hull-cleaning, painting and general drydocking services apart from steel and pipe works.

 ODESSOS Shiprepair Yard S.A. is situated at the southern end of the city of Varna, on the island between the old and new canals connecting Black Sea and the Lake of Varna and is about one mile far from the mouth of Port Varna. Spread over an area of about 320,000 square meters, Odessos is the largest well equipped yard in Bulgaria suitable for repair and drydocking of vessels up to 35,000 DWT and afloat repairs of vessels up to 150,000 DWT.

 The "Adriatic Shipyard Bijela" is the biggest shiprepairing yard in the Southern Adriatic. It is located in Boka Kotorska bay, one of the safest natural harbours in the world, and has centuries long shipbuilding and maritime tradition.

 Malta has provided shipyard services in the commercial sector since the mid 1960s. Recently created Malta Shipyards Ltd is made up of the Cospicua Site (Malta Dry Docks), the Marsa Site (Malta Shipbuilding Company Limited), Manoel Island Yacht Yard Limited and the Malta Shipyards Tank Cleaning Station. Employing over 1700 English speaking, skilled tradesmen the company is one of the largest employers in Malta.

 50 years of experience and reliability of the Kiran Holding Co. at your service. The facility is the largest commercial shiprepair yard in Tuzla Bay. TK Tuzla Shipyard owns one of the biggest floating docks in the world, with particulars: 350m length, 65m inner breadth and 100,000 tons lifting capacity. The yard was acquired by the Kiran Holding Co.
